The “Ashoka Text-To-Speech (TTS) Voice” is a high-quality neural technology-based solution tailored specifically for Sinhala content. While basic English support is available for configuration purposes, please note that this voice may not be suitable for other tasks in English.
Configuring Ashoka TTS with NVDA
Follow these steps to configure Ashoka TTS with NVDA:
- Unzip the “Ashoka TTS” folder.
- Locate and run the “ashokaPiperTTS-1.0.1.nvda-addon” file. NVDA will prompt you to install this add-on. Press “Yes” to initiate and complete the add-on installation.
- Restart NVDA.
- With NVDA running, press the NVDA key along with the “N” key to open the NVDA menu. This could be either “Insert” or “Caps Lock” depending on your keyboard layout.
- Use the up or down arrow keys to select “Piper Voice Manager” and press “Enter” to open it.
- Press “Tab” to locate the “Install from Local File” button, then press “Space Bar” or “Enter” to activate it.
- A standard “Open Dialog Box” will appear. Navigate to the “si-ashoka-low.tar.gz” file and press “Enter” on the file.
- A success message will be displayed. Press “OK” to close the dialog box.
- Find and copy the “si_dict” file supplied in the “Ashoka TTS” folder.
- Paste it into C:\Program Files (x86)\NVDA\synthDrivers\espeak-ng-data, and continue replacing with administrator privilege.
How to use the TTS with NVDA
To utilize the installed voice for reading Sinhala content, follow these steps:
- When you wish to read a Sinhala document, switch the TTS (Text-to-Speech) of NVDA by pressing “NVDA + Control + S.”
- Use the up or down arrow keys to select “Piper Neural Voices” and press “Enter.”
For example, to read a Sinhala news article, first open the article in your web browser. Then, press NVDA+control+s to open the TTS selection menu. Use the up or down arrow keys to select “Piper neural voices” and press enter. NVDA will now read the article in Sinhala using the Ashoka TTS Voice.
